An Overview of High-availability (HA) Computing Software 
It is increasingly important for a business to support continued access to global
information 24/7. What’s more, careers often depend on the availability of service levels
provided by IT to the enterprise. 
In computer science, availability refers to the degree to which a system or resource is
capable of performing its normal function. Availability is measured in terms of Mean Time
Between Failure (MTBF) divided by MTBF plus the Mean Time to Repair (MTTR). 
AVAILABILITY = MTBF / (MTBF+MTTR) 
For example, a server that fails on average once every 5,000 hours and takes an average
of two hours to diagnose, replace faulty components, and reboot, would have an availability
rating of 5,000/(5,000 + 2) = 99.96%. This would correspond to a Level 3 rating using the
Scale of 9s.
S o f t w a re Products Contribute to High-availability Computing
Many factors can cause unplanned downtime. The Hitachi Freedom Storage
Lightning 9900
V Series has been designed to eliminate as many of these factors as
possible in hardware redundancy, online replaceable components, and software data copy
functions. This allows copies of data at other locations either locally or remotely so that
processing can continue in the event of an outage. 
Backup and restore procedures and products also contribute dramatically to computer
system availability by reducing the time to restore operations in the event of an outage.

The Lightning 9900 V Series Has an Advanced Availability Profile Compared to
Competitive Pro d u c t s
The Lightning 9900 V Series was designed with maximum emphasis on high-
availability computing for today’s most critical enterprises, including:
System microcode that can be upgraded nondisruptively
3
Active/active dual-ported disk drives instead of single-port drives or active/passive
dual-ported drives
Redundant active components throughout the system, combined with automatic 
failover architecture
